In 2026, skywatchers and astronomy enthusiasts have reason to look upward with excitement.
Among the year’s most remarkable celestial phenomena is an extended planetary alignment, often described as a “planet parade,” in which multiple planets in our solar system appear in a near‑straight line across the evening sky.
This event is not a dramatic straight‑line configuration in space — no such perfect line ever truly exists, but rather a vantage‑point illusion from Earth where several planets appear clustered along the ecliptic, the imaginary path the Sun takes across the sky.

What Exactly Is a Planetary Alignment?

A planetary alignment refers to a situation in which several planets orbiting the Sun appear to gather in a confined region of the sky when viewed from Earth. Because the planets orbit in roughly the same plane — the ecliptic, this optical convergence is possible and detectable without specialized equipment in some cases. These alignments do not imply that the planets are physically lined up in space, but rather that their positions project into a visually clustered pattern against the backdrop of stars.
Astronomers sometimes call this phenomenon a planet parade because it evokes a sequence of bright dots moving together across the evening sky. For 2026, the most anticipated sequence occurs over the late February period, culminating around February 28, when six planets appear in a broad alignment visible shortly after sunset.

The Six Planets of 2026’s Celestial Parade

The alignment that makes 2026 particularly interesting includes Mercury, Venus, Jupiter, Saturn, Uranus, and Neptune. Each of these worlds moves at a different speed along its orbit, but at certain times the geometry from Earth’s perspective causes them to gather along the ecliptic in a compact formation.
Here’s how these bodies will typically present themselves:
- Venus stands out as the brightest object in the alignment after the Moon, easily visible to the unaided eye as it hovers near the western horizon.
- Jupiter gleams steadily and is often one of the easiest planets to spot because of its high brightness and elevation in the sky.
- Saturn can also be seen without optics in many locations, though it appears less brilliant than Jupiter or Venus.
- Mercury adds a subtle challenge; its proximity to the Sun means it sets quickly after dusk and may be easy to miss without a clear horizon.
- Uranus and Neptune are fainter and generally require binoculars or a small telescope to be distinguished.

When and Where to Observe the 2026 Alignment

The highlight of this celestial configuration is centered around February 28, 2026, making late February an especially rewarding time for sky observation. On that evening, observers with unobstructed views toward the western and southwestern sky just after sunset will have the best opportunity to spot the planetary parade as it arcs across the horizon.
Unlike some alignments that require early morning hours before sunrise, this 2026 event unfolds conveniently in the evening, making it accessible to families and casual observers — provided the sky is clear and light pollution is limited.
Because the alignment spans many degrees of sky, the planets will not be tightly packed in one spot; instead, they trace a gentle curve as they reflect sunlight, following the ecliptic path. The precise timing and spacing can vary by geographic location, so local astronomical societies often provide tailored guidance to help observers plan their viewings.

Scientific and Cultural Significance

Celestial alignments like the one in 2026 hold both scientific and cultural appeal. Historically, such parades have helped astronomers refine models of planetary motion and assisted early scientists in understanding the mechanics of the solar system. Today they remain valuable observational opportunities that allow amateur astronomers to engage with planetary dynamics in real time.
From a scientific standpoint, observing multiple planets simultaneously can help illustrate how each world’s orbit intersects with human perspective — a daily reminder of the dynamic nature of our solar system. Unlike eclipses, which are brief and dramatic, the slow shifting of a planetary alignment offers a more gradual and contemplative encounter with celestial mechanics.

Viewing Tips for Enthusiasts

For those planning to observe the alignment, preparation enhances the experience. Finding a location with a clear and low western horizon is key, since Mercury and Venus will be closest to the sunset. Starting observation about 30–60 minutes after sunset maximizes the chances of seeing the full lineup before the planets set.
Using sky map apps or star charts can help identify planets more confidently, especially for the dimmer outer worlds. Binoculars or a small telescope will bring out Uranus and Neptune, and even reveal subtle differences in brightness and color that are not obvious to the unaided eye.
